Technical Specifications

Technical Data
Body Style:
4 Door Sedan
Drivetrain:
All Wheel Drive
EPA Classification:
Compact
Passenger Capacity:
5
Passenger Volume (ft³):
93.5
Base Curb Weight (lbs):
3462
EPA Fuel Economy Est - City (MPG):
17
EPA Fuel Economy Est - Hwy (MPG):
25
Engine Type:
Gas I4
Displacement:
2.0L/122
Fuel System:
MPI
SAE Net Horsepower @ RPM:
237 @ 6000
SAE Net Torque @ RPM:
253 @ 3000
Trans Description Cont.:
Manual
Suspension Type - Front:
MacPherson Strut
Suspension Type - Rear:
Multi-Link
Front Tire Size:
P215/45R18
Rear Tire Size:
P215/45R18
Spare Tire Size:
Compact
Front Wheel Size (in):
18 x 7.5
Rear Wheel Size (in):
18 x 7.5
Front Wheel Material:
Aluminum
Rear Wheel Material:
Aluminum
Brake ABS System:
4-Wheel
Disc - Front (Yes or ):
Yes
Disc - Rear (Yes or ):
Yes
Rear Brake Rotor Diam x Thickness (in):
11.9 x - TBD -
Fuel Tank Capacity, Approx (gal):
15.3
Wheelbase (in):
103.7
Length, Overall (in):
180.0
Trunk Volume (ft³):
12.3
